I bought this pump on AliExpress.

The exact dimensions of the cylinder are:

63 mm diameter (bottom, where your D goes in)
58 mm diameter (top, where the pump is)
205 mm insertable length.

The silicone sleeve is quite comfortable and replacement sleeves are easy to get and cheap. They don’t wear out quickly though, so haven’t needed any yet.

For me the size is ok: my normal EG is about 15 cm and my pumped length is about 19 cm, so still 15 mm to go. And length does not come easy, pumping.

You can buy your own cylinder if you need one with a smaller diameter and/or a longer one. As long as one side has as diameter of 58 mm you connect/insert the pump there. It has a rubber ring to seal itself inside the cylinder.

It does leak a bit, usually, but the pump has a setting [2] that automatically adjusts the pressure to one of the 4 selectable preset levels of -30, -40, -45 and -50 kPa. Not sure how much pressure that is in mm Hg.

With setting [1] it just keeps on pumping, and the pressure goes up (down?) to around -60 kPa, which feels like an awful lot of negative pressure.

It would be nice if the pump were programmable, and able to modulate pressure and such, but I have not seen a pump that can do that yet.
For this pump I think it should not be all that difficult for the manufacturer to enhance its function for that. Maybe even give it a bluetooth interface and have an app to control it.

I pulled the trigger and bought this:
https://www.ama … /dp/B01KNLSDEU/

The pump itself works pretty well actually. However the cylinder is a little too wide, pulls in too much even with the sleeve on. I solved this by cutting (and smoothing) the top off an old cylinder and it slid inside this cylinder and made an air tight seal, with the appropriate diameter for me. The length is also a bit short at about 7.25", but this was also solved when I slid the narrower cylinder inside as it added another 0.5" or so to the length.

There are 4 settings on the pump that range from about 4 inhg up to about 12. The beauty of this pump is that it is fully automatic. If the pressure falls, the pump kicks on and brings it back up to target, hands free. I’ve kept it on for almost an hour and it was flawless.
